About

Dimitrios Papanagnou is a scholar working on Public Health, Environmental and Occupational Health, Family Practice and Physiology. According to data from OpenAlex, Dimitrios Papanagnou has authored 81 papers receiving a total of 746 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 44 papers in Public Health, Environmental and Occupational Health, 27 papers in Family Practice and 20 papers in Physiology. Recurrent topics in Dimitrios Papanagnou’s work include Innovations in Medical Education (37 papers), Clinical Reasoning and Diagnostic Skills (27 papers) and Simulation-Based Education in Healthcare (19 papers). Dimitrios Papanagnou is often cited by papers focused on Innovations in Medical Education (37 papers), Clinical Reasoning and Diagnostic Skills (27 papers) and Simulation-Based Education in Healthcare (19 papers). Dimitrios Papanagnou collaborates with scholars based in United States, Canada and Japan. Dimitrios Papanagnou's co-authors include Xiao Chi Zhang, Hyunjoo Lee, Teresa M. Chan, Shruti Chandra, Rebecca Jaffe, Danielle M. McCarthy, Kristin L. Rising, Rhea E. Powell, Richard Sinert and Nethra Ankam and has published in prestigious journals such as Academic Medicine, Annals of Emergency Medicine and Medical Education.
